Intern
So, first there was a call from HR about 7 days after applying, just to check if I was still up for potentially talking with the warehouse manager. Then, about 10 to 15 days later, I had a Teams meeting with the manager.
- What was the biggest critical issue you encountered in previous experiences
Intern
First, there was a short introduction round, then they asked about goals and skills. They wanted to know what my goals are for the internship and how I envision it. Regarding skills, they asked a lot about my handling of several specific programs.
- What is your goal for your time in the position?
Intern
I applied online for the Intern position, and the whole thing took about a week. After that, I had the interview. It wasn't too tough if you get ready beforehand - the interview questions are pretty much stuff you should know to keep it all consistent with your resume.
- Can you tell me about yourself?
- What about your work experience?
- What are your strengths?
